Shareholders and potential investors of the Company should exercise caution when dealing in the shares of the Company.– 2 –INTRODUCTIONReference is made to the announcement of the Company dated 4 December 2023 (the “PreviousAnnouncement”) in relation to the Disposal.The Board is pleased to announce that on 23 June 2024 Pacific Smart (an indirect wholly- owned subsidiary of the Company) and the Purchaser entered into the Formal Sale and Purchase Agreement pursuant to which Pacific Smart conditionally agreed to sell and the Purchaser conditionally agreed to purchase the Sale Shares.FORMAL SALE AND PURCHASE AGREEMENT The principal terms of the Formal Sale and Purchase Agreement are set out as follows: Date 23 June 2024 Parties (i) Pacific Smart (as vendor); and (ii) the Purchaser.Pacific Smart held 8235293 class A preferred shares in the issued share capital (representing approximately 4.00% shareholding as at the date of this Announcement and approximately 3.48% shareholding on a fully-diluted basis) of the Target Company as at the date of the Formal Sale and Purchase Agreement.Subject Matter Pacific Smart has conditionally agreed to sell the Sale Shares being 8235293 class A preferred shares (representing approximately 4.00% shareholding as at the date of this Announcement and approximately 3.48% shareholding on a fully-diluted basis) of the Target Company to the Purchaser at the Completion Date. The Sale Shares represent all the class A preferred shares of the Target Company held by Pacific Smart as at the date of the Formal Sale and Purchase Agreement.– 3 –Consideration The Consideration payable to Pacific Smart by the Purchaser for the Sale Shares is US$21559218 (equivalent to approximately RMB156.6 million converted at the Announcement Exchange Rate). Therefore the price for each Sale Share is US$2.6179.Simultaneously with the signing of the Formal Sale and Purchase Agreement the Purchaser also entered into the Main SPA with the Other Vendors and the Target Company for purchasing 115518410 shares (representing approximately 56.15% shareholding as at the date of this Announcement and approximately 48.78% shareholding on a fully-diluted basis) in the Target Company at the price of US$2.6179 per share.The Consideration was arrived at after arms-length negotiations between Pacific Smart the Other Vendors and the Purchaser and having taken into account the value of the Target Company at RMB4125 million (equivalent to approximately US$582.4 million converted at the Valuation Exchange Rate) in accordance with the Valuation Report. The Parties have also taken into account (i) the potential dilution effect of the 31115675 Employee Share Options which may be exercised at the exercise price of US$1.19 per Employee Share Option as the Parties consider that the exercise of the Employee Share Options will affect both the value of the Target Company and the value per share of the Target Company; and (ii) the fact that the Other Vendors are also selling their shares in the Target Company to the Purchaser at the same price of US$2.6179 per share.Therefore the Board considers that it is fair and reasonable to take these factors into account for arriving at the amount of the Consideration.If all the 31115675 Employee Share Options are exercised in full the enlarged share capital of the Target Company will consist of 236830561 issued shares and the value of the Target Company will increase by approximately US$37 million from approximately US$582.4 million (as per the Valuation) to approximately US$620 million and therefore the value per share will become approximately US$2.6179. As Pacific Smart holds 8235293 class A preferred shares in the Target Company the Parties agree that the Consideration shall be US$21559218.The ESOP Participants Representative the Purchaser and the Target Company entered into an agreement on 23 June 2024 pursuant to which the Purchaser agrees to purchase all the Employee Share Options from their holders upon fulfilment of certain performance targets by the Target Company in the financial years ending 31 December 2024 2025 and 2026.To the best of the knowledge information and belief of the Directors having made all reasonable enquires all other shareholders of the Target Company (including but not limited to the Other Vendors) and all the holders of Employee Share Options are Independent Third Parties.– 4 –The Valuation According to the Valuation Report prepared by the Valuer engaged by the Purchaser the Target Company was valued at RMB4125 million as at 31 December 2023 (equivalent to approximately US$582.4 million if converted at the Valuation Exchange Rate; and equivalent to approximately US$567.7 million if converted at the Announcement Exchange Rate).The Valuation Report does not state any value per share of the Target Company.In preparing the Valuation Report the Valuer has relied upon (inter alia): 1. the audited consolidated financial statements of the Target Company for the two financial years ended 31 December 2022 and 2023; 2. corporate documents of the Target Group; 3. title documents invoices agreements certificates and other documentary proofs of the material assets and intellectual property rights owned by the Target Group; and 4. various asset valuation rules regulations and guidance published in the PRC. The Valuation is based upon the assumption that the Target Company will continue to operate as a going concern.In arriving at the market value of the Target Company of RMB4125 million as at 31 December 2023 the Valuer adopted market approach in valuing the Target Company. Market value isdefined as “the estimated amount for which the valuation target (i.e. the Target Company)should exchange on 31 December 2023 being the valuation date between a willing buyer and a willing seller in an arm’s length transaction and where the parties had each acted knowledgeablyprudently and without compulsion”.The Valuer has adopted market approach in preparing the Valuation Report as it considers that the capital market constituted by the Shanghai Stock Exchange and Shenzhen Stock Exchange has sufficient number of companies (i.e. market comparables) which are in the same industry in which the Target Group is running its business and that the Valuer is able to obtain the market information financial information and other relevant information of the market comparables from the public information in the capital market. The Valuer has conducted the Valuation by comparing the Target Company with the market comparables based on their enterprise value- to-revenue (EV/R) and enterprise value-to-total assets (EV/total assets).– 5 –Payment of Consideration The Consideration shall be satisfied in cash by the Purchaser to Pacific Smart by instalments: (i) the 1st Instalment of US$10995201 (equivalent to approximately RMB79891130 converted at the Announcement Exchange Rate) representing 51% of the Consideration shall be payable by the Purchaser within 10 Business Days after the date on which all the conditions precedents for the 1st Instalment set out below have been satisfied; (ii) the 2nd Instalment of US$10564017 (equivalent to approximately RMB76758148 converted at the Announcement Exchange Rate) representing the remaining 49% of the Consideration shall be payable by the Purchaser within 10 Business Days after the expiry of nine months’ period from the date of the Formal Sale and Purchase Agreement but in any event not later than 31 March 2025 subject to the fulfilment of all the conditions precedent for the 2nd Instalment.Conditions Precedent for the 1st Instalment The payment of the 1st Instalment by the Purchaser is conditional upon the following conditions (unless otherwise specified in the Formal Sale and Purchase Agreement) being satisfied: (a) the Formal Sale and Purchase Agreement and an undertaking to be given by Pacific Smart according to “Rules in relation to Material Assets Reorganisation*” (重大资产重组相关法 律法规应签署) having been duly signed become effective and delivered to the Purchaser; (b) completion of the respective necessary internal decision-making procedures by the Parties in particular for the sale of the Sale Shares by Pacific Smart the approval by the Shareholders of the Formal Sale and Purchase Agreement and the transactions contemplated thereby; (c) Pacific Smart having executed and delivered the instrument of transfer in the form prescribed in the Formal Sale and Purchase Agreement specifying that the transfer shall be effective on the date the 1st Instalment has been paid; (d) resolutions have been passed by the shareholders of the Target Company to appoint 6 individuals nominated by the Purchaser as the directors of the Target Company with effect from the Completion Date and that the originals of such resolutions have been duly delivered to the Purchaser; (e) there having no circumstances in the aspects of commercial or technical or legal or financial or other relevant area that would result in a direct economic loss for the Target Company exceeding US$12.4 million; – 6 –(f) the Purchaser has completed all the necessary procedures required by the relevant government departments and authorities in relation to overseas direct investment and foreign exchange; (g) the representations and warranties given by Pacific Smart and the Target Company under the Formal Sale and Purchase Agreement remain to be true accurate and complete in all material respects as at the Completion Date and in the event of any inaccuracies or omissions such inaccuracies or omissions will not result in a direct economic loss for the Target Company exceeding US$12.4 million; (h) there being no laws rules judicial or governmental judgments rulings injunctions or any undecided or anticipated litigations arbitrations judgments rulings injunctions that may adversely affect the parties to the Formal Sale and Purchase Agreement or the transactions contemplated thereby and if any such circumstances exists those circumstances would not result in a direct economic loss for the Target Company exceeding US$12.4 million; (i) the China Securities Regulatory Commission the Shanghai Stock Exchange and otherrelevant regulatory authorities issuing no objection according to the “Rules on MaterialAsset Reorganisation for A-Shares*” (A股重大资产重组规则) upon fulfilment of the above conditions precedent and if any such objection is issued the Purchaser shall illustrate to Pacific Smart in relation to that objection in writing or by any other instrument; and (j) the Target Company and holders of over 51% of the voting right in the Target Company have provided a written confirmation to the Purchaser that the relevant consideration has been satisfied in full.The Formal Sale and Purchase Agreement does not expressly provide any time period and reference basis for calculating the “direct economic loss for the Target Company” in paragraphs (e) (g) and (h) above. In view of this conditions precedent Completion may not proceed if the Other Vendors do not sell their shares in the Target Company or any part thereof to the Purchaser.Following Completion the Company will cease to have any interests in the Target Company.INFORMATION ON THE TARGET GROUP Source Photonics Holdings (Cayman) Limited Source Photonics Holdings (Cayman) Limited is a company incorporated in the Cayman Islands with limited liability. Its principal businesses are designing manufacturing and selling of a broad portfolio of optical communications devices components modules and subsystems used in communication networks.The Target Group The Target Group is a leading global provider of advanced technology solutions for optical communications and data connectivity.Set out below is a combined financial summary of the fair value of the Company’s investment in the Target Company as extracted from the annual reports of the Company for the two financial years ended 31 December 2022 and 2023 which were prepared in accordance with the IFRS: Year ended 31 December 20232022 (Audited) (Audited) RMB’000 RMB’000 Financial assets at fair value through profit and loss (“FVTPL”) Opening balance 167150 153016 Change in fair value of financial asset at FVTPL (13029) – Foreign exchange gains – 14134 Closing balance 154121 167150 – 10 –The Company’s investment in the Target Company has been recognised and measured at fair value at the end of each reporting period as a level 3 instrument i.e. financial assets at FVTPL which is not traded in an active market and its valuation was undertaken by APAC Appraisal and Consulting Limited an independent qualified professional valuer. Market approach was used to determine the underlying equity value of the Company and guideline public company method model were adopted to determine the fair value of the Company’s investment in the Target Company at FVTPL as at 31 December 2022 and 31 December 2023.Set out below is the net profits/(loss) (both before and after taxation) of the Target Company as extracted from its audited consolidated financial statements for the two financial years ended 31 December 2022 and 2023 which were prepared in accordance with the Chinese Accounting Standards: Year ended 31 December 20232022 (Audited) (Audited) RMB’000 RMB’000 Net profits/(loss) (before taxation) (16230) 138069 Net profits/(loss) (after taxation) (17499) 124567 INFORMATION ON THE VENDOR Pacific Smart is a company incorporated with limited liability in the BVI and an indirect wholly- owned subsidiary of the Company. Pacific Smart is principally engaged in investment holding.INFORMATION ON THE COMPANY AND THE GROUP The Company is a well-established supplier for optical telecommunication products with the Group’s headquarters based in Changzhou City Jiangsu Province the PRC. The Group is principally engaged in manufacturing and sales of a wide range of optical fibre cable products and related devices as well as processing and sales of prepainted steel sheets. The Group’s customers principally include national and regional telecommunications network operators and telecommunications supporting services providers in the PRC.INFORMATION ON THE PURCHASER The Purchaser is a company incorporated with limited liability in the PRC the A shares of which are listed on the Shanghai Stock Exchange (stock code: 600246). The Purchaser is principally engaged in three core businesses namely (i) real estate development and sales; (ii) urban renewal and operation; and (iii) telecommunication and digital technology.– 11 –To the best of the Directors’ knowledge information and belief and upon having made all reasonable enquiries each of the Purchaser and its ultimate beneficial owners is an Independent Third Party.FINANCIAL EFFECT OF THE DISPOSAL According to the Company’s annual report for the financial year ended 31 December 2022 the Company has recognized foreign exchange gains of approximately RMB14134000 through its investment in the Target Company and according to the Company’s annual report for the financial year ended 31 December 2023 the Company has recognized fair value loss of approximately RMB13029000 through its investment in the Target Company.Since the interest in the Target Company held by the Company is less than 5% the Target Company is not a subsidiary of the Company. The Group intends to use the net cash proceeds as general working capital for the daily operations of the Group and expansion of the Group’s business when there is suitable opportunity.– 12 –REASONS AND BENEFITS OF THE DISPOSAL As disclosed in the Previous Announcement it was expected positive business synergies could be generated by the Group’s acquisition of the Sale Shares in 2020. However due to changes in the management of the Target Group and a shift of the Target Group’s business strategy the expected positive business synergies have not materialized.As a result the Board considers that the Disposal provides a good opportunity to liquidate the Group’s investment in the Target Company so that the Group can strengthen its cash position which can better equip itself to withstand any market downturn as well as provision of a cash reserve for any future investment if any such opportunity arises.
